Leaves and roots of 19 species and six subspecies of Hawaiian Bidens were examined for polyacetylenes. Eleven C13 hydrocarbons, aromatic and thiophenyl derivatives, one C14 tetrahydropyran and three C17 hydrocarbons were isolated all identified. All can be derived from a common precursor, oleic acid. Polyacetylenes were not detected in the leaves of 13 taxa although they are found in the roots of all. The occurrence of 2-[2-phenyl-ethyne-1-yl]-5 acetoxymethyl thiopene in Bidens has not been previously reported. Its ubiquitous presence is consistent with other evidence that the Hawaiian species are all derived from a single ancestral immigrant to the islands. Most taxa could be distinguished by their complement of polyacetylenes in roots and leaves. No variation was found to occur within taxa except in B. torta, in which each population had a unique array of polyacetylenes. Above the species level there appeared to be no taxonomically significant pattern to the distribution of polyacetylenes in this group.  相似文献

Summary Recent advances in the ability to culture the hepatic forms of mammalian malaria parasites, particularly of the important human pathogen Plasmodium falciparum have provided novel opportunities to study the ultrastrucural organisation of the parasite in its natural host cell the human hepatocyte. In this electron-microscopic and immunofluorescence study we have found the morphology of both parasite and host cell to be well preserved. The exoerythrocytic forms, which may be found at densities of up to 100/cm2, grow at rates comparable to that in vivo in the chimpanzee. In the multiplying 5- and 7-day schizogonic forms the ultrastructural organisation of the parasite bears striking resemblances to other mammalian parasites, e.g., the secretory activity and distribution of the peripheral vacuole system, but also homology with avian parasites, e.g., in nuclear and nucleolar structure and mitochondrial form. The latter homologies support earlier suggestions of the close phylogenetic relationship of P. falciparum with the avian parasites. Evidence is also presented showing the persistence of the cytoskeleton of the invasive sporozoite within the cytoplasm of the ensuing rapidly growing vegetative parasites.  相似文献

Population dynamics of microfilarial production and eosinophilic levels in slow lorises infected with Breinlia sergenti, Petter (Filarioidea: Dipetalonematidae). International Journal for Parsitology 4: 383388. Observations have been made on microfilarial and eosinophilic levels in slow lorises infected with Breinlia sergenti. Animals given a single inoculation of 100-150 infective larvae exhibited three different patterns of microfilaraemia while superinfected animals showed enhanced microfilarial levels. It appeared that the number of inoculations as well as the interval between inocula are important factors in enhancing microfilarial levels. Two different types of incubation periods were seen, one at 100-120 days and the other at 200 days. The eosinophilic levels were investigated in some of the animals and an attempt was made to correlate these levels with the microfilaraemia. Cortisone injection appeared to promote a vigorous eosinophilia in some of the infected animals tested.  相似文献

William Yap 《Biophysical journal》1973,13(11):1160-1165
A model for the binding of ions to oligopeptides, in which nearest neighbor interactions are considered is developed. Equations for the titration curves are derived The apparent association constants are determined as a function of the degree of polymerization and of the interactions between nearest neighbors.  相似文献

OBJECTIVE--To confirm the findings of pilot studies that interferon alfa is an effective treatment of Europid men with chronic hepatitis B virus infection. DESIGN--Randomised controlled trial of three months treatment with interferon alfa followed by 12 months of observation. SETTING--Outpatient clinic of a tertiary referral centre. PATIENTS--37 Treated men (six anti-HIV positive) and 34 untreated men (nine anti-HIV positive) who met the criteria for the trial. Four controls failed to complete follow up. INTERVENTIONS--The treated group received subcutaneous injections of 5-10 MU interferon alfa/m2 daily for five days, then 10 MU/m2 thrice weekly for 11 weeks. Follow up continued at monthly intervals for 12 months. Untreated controls were monitored over the same period. MAIN OUTCOME MEASURE--Hepatitis B e antigen and hepatitis B virus DNA state after 15 months of observation. RESULTS--12 Of the 37 treated patients cleared hepatitis B e antigen and hepatitis B virus DNA, whereas only one of 30 untreated controls seroconverted over the same period--an increased response rate of 29% (95% confidence interval 13% to 45%). The life table estimate of response at 15 months was 35% in treated patients, an increase of 32% above controls (95% confidence interval 16% to 48%). The response rates in groups by predictive pretreatment variables were 12 of 31 anti-HIV negative patients (excess response 34%; 95% confidence interval 14% to 54%), 12 of 26 with chronic active hepatitis before treatment (excess response 46%; 27% to 65%), and 12 of 21 with a pretreatment serum aspartate aminotransferase activity greater than 70 IU/l (excess response 46%; 16% to 76%). The combination of these factors predicted response with a sensitivity of 100% and a specificity of 80%. Four of the 12 responders, who had all been infected for less than two years, also lost hepatitis B surface antigen. Treatment was well tolerated. CONCLUSIONS--Interferon alfa is effective in the treatment of a proportion of Europid men with chronic hepatitis B virus infection, who might be identified before treatment. Additional strategies are required to improve the rate of response.  相似文献

A novel model lipid bilayer membrane is prepared by the addition of phospholipid vesicles to alkanethiol monolayers on gold. This supported hybrid bilayer membrane is rugged, easily and reproducibly prepared in the absence of organic solvent, and is stable for very long periods of time. We have characterized the insulating characteristics of this membrane by examining the rate of electron transfer and by impedance spectroscopy. Supported hybrid bilayers formed from phospholipids and alkanethiols are pinhole-free and demonstrate measured values of conductivity and resistivity which are within an order of magnitude of that reported for black lipid membranes. Capacitance values suggest a dielectric constant of 2.7 for phospholipid membranes in the absence of organic solvent. The protein toxin, melittin, destroys the insulating capability of the phospholipid layer without significantly altering the bilayer structure. This model membrane will allow the assessment of the effect of lipid membrane perturbants on the insulating properties of natural lipid membranes.  相似文献

In a previous study, we have identified endonexin II (E-II) on human liver plasma membranes as a specific, Ca(2+)-dependent, small hepatitis B surface antigen (HBsAg)-binding protein. In this article, we describe the spontaneous development of anti-HBs antibodies in rabbits immunized with native or recombinant human liver E-II and in chickens immunized with the F(ab')2 fragment of rabbit anti-human liver E-II immunoglobulin G. Anti-HBs activity was not observed in rabbits immunized with rat liver E-II. Cross-reactivity of anti-E-II antibodies to HBsAg epitopes was excluded, since anti-HBs and anti-E-II activities can be separated by E-II affinity chromatography. The existence of an anti-idiotypic antibody is further demonstrated by competitive binding of human liver E-II and this antibody (Ab2) to small HBsAg, suggesting that Ab2 mimics a specific E-II epitope that interacts with small HBsAg. In addition, it was demonstrated that anti-HBs antibodies developed in rabbits after immunization with intact human liver E-II or in chickens after immunization with F(ab')2 fragments of rabbit anti-human liver E-II immunoglobulin G recognize the same epitopes on small HBsAg. These findings strongly indicate that human liver E-II is a very specific small HBsAg-binding protein and support the assumption that human liver E-II is the hepatitis B virus receptor protein.  相似文献
